Safa College of Arts and Science is affiliated with the University of Calicut and offers a wide range of undergraduate and postgraduate programs across arts, commerce, and science streams. Safa College of Arts and Science admission process is divided into merit-based admissions and management quota admissions.
Merit-based admissions account for 50% of the seats and are conducted through the University of Calicut’s centralized single window system, while the remaining 50% are filled under the management quota by the college. Safa College of Arts and Science Application Process The application process of Safa College of Arts and Science has been made simple and easy.
Here is a guide explaining the steps to the application Visit the official University of Calicut website when admissions are open. Register on the university’s online portal and create an account. Fill out the online application form with personal and academic details. Upload scanned copies of the required documents. Pay the application fee online as specified by the university.
Submit the completed application and save/print a copy for reference. For management quota admissions, candidates must contact the college directly to obtain and complete the college-specific application process. Await merit list or selection notification from the university or college. If selected, report to the college for document verification and admission confirmation.
Pay the required fees and complete the admission formalities within the given deadline. Safa College of Arts and Science Degree-wise Admission Process Safa College of Arts and Science currently runs twelve courses in which it presents undergraduate and postgraduate classes. Students can check the course details mentioned below Safa College of Arts and Science B. A. Admission Process B. A.
Programs: Includes Journalism and Mass Communication, Economics with Foreign Trade , and English and Literature. Admission is based on 10+2 performance. Merit seats are filled via the University of Calicut’s single window system; management seats are filled by the college. Safa College of Arts and Science B. Sc. Admission Process B. Sc. Programs: Offered in Physics, Psychology, and Geography .
Eligibility includes 10+2 with relevant science subjects. 50% of seats are merit-based and 50% are under management quota. Safa College of Arts and Science B. Com Admission Process B. Com Programs: Includes specializations in Computer Applications and Finance . Preference is given to students with a commerce background. The admission follows the standard 50-50 split.
Safa College of Arts and Science Admission Process for BCA, BBA, and BSW BCA, BBA , BSW: These professional programs follow the same admission division—half of the seats through merit, half through management quota. Safa College of Arts and Science Admission Process for M. Com and MA Postgraduate Programs ( M. Com , M. A. English, M. A. Economics): Require a relevant bachelor's degree.
